Usi di JavaScript:

Javascript è una delle lingue più utilizzate sul mercato in questi giorni. Il grafico seguente mostra una rappresentazione grafica di un'azienda per tutte le lingue. JavaScript è al secondo posto nella gamma. Viene utilizzato principalmente nella creazione di siti Web e applicazioni Web. L'altra applicazione di JavaScript è elencata di seguito.

Primi 10 usi di JavaScript:

Di seguito è riportato l'elenco dei primi 10 usi di JavaScript sono i seguenti:

1. Sviluppo Web:

JavaScript è un linguaggio di scripting client utilizzato per la creazione di pagine Web. È un linguaggio autonomo sviluppato in Netscape. Viene utilizzato quando una pagina Web deve essere dinamica e aggiungere effetti speciali su pagine come rollover, roll-out e molti tipi di grafica. Viene utilizzato principalmente da tutti i siti Web ai fini della convalida. Oltre alle convalide, supporta applicazioni esterne come documenti PDF, l'esecuzione di widget, il supporto per applicazioni flash, ecc. Può anche caricare il contenuto in un documento ogni volta che l'utente lo richiede senza nemmeno ricaricare l'intera pagina.

2. Applicazioni Web:

Con la tecnologia, i browser e i personal computer sono migliorati in misura tale da rendere necessaria una lingua per creare applicazioni Web affidabili. Quando un utente esplora una mappa in Google Maps, l'utente deve semplicemente fare clic e trascinare il mouse. Tutta la vista dettagliata è visibile con un semplice clic. Ciò è possibile grazie a JavaScript. Interagisce con il browser senza inviare messaggi da e verso i server. JavaScript utilizza le API (Application Programming Interface) che forniscono ulteriori poteri al codice.

3.Presentations:

JavaScript fornisce anche la possibilità di creare presentazioni come sito Web. JavaScript fornisce le librerie RevealJS e BespokeJS per creare un deck slide basato sul web. Reveal.js crea alcuni dei mazzi più belli e interattivi utilizzando HTML. Un utente può facilmente inserire diapositive nidificate. Anche se l'utente non è a conoscenza del linguaggio di programmazione, può facilmente creare un sito con così tanto aiuto online. Queste presentazioni sono ottimizzate per il tocco e funzionano perfettamente con dispositivi mobili, telefoni e tablet. Con tutto questo JavaScript fornisce anche diversi stili di transizione, temi e sfondi delle diapositive. Supporta tutti i formati di colore CSS. JavaScript fornisce inoltre il plug-in Bespoke.js con una vasta gamma di funzionalità. Questi includono ridimensionamento reattivo, elenchi puntati animati ed evidenziazione della sintassi per esempi di codice. Fornisce temi che sono raffinati e non troppo appariscenti. Il modo più rapido per avviare Bespoke.js è utilizzare un generatore. Consente all'utente di impostare i titoli per la presentazione e passare una serie di domande per ottenere i plug-in richiesti.

4. Applicazioni server:

Node JS è basato sul runtime Javascript di Chrome per la creazione di applicazioni di rete veloci e scalabili. Utilizza applicazioni guidate dagli eventi, leggere ed efficienti che devono essere distribuite sui sistemi con l'aiuto di un server. Javascript è utilizzato per gestire le richieste HTTP e generare contenuti. Quando un utente sta scrivendo applicazioni spesse in JavaScript sul client, un utente può persino scrivere la logica in JavaScript sul server in modo che i salti cognitivi possano essere fatti da una lingua all'altra.

5. Server Web:

Utilizzando Node JS è possibile creare un server Web. I vantaggi di Node JS sono che è guidato dagli eventi e non aspetterebbe la risposta della chiamata precedente. Passa alla chiamata successiva e sfrutta gli eventi per ricevere notifiche quando si riceve una risposta per una chiamata precedente. I server basati su Node JS sono molto veloci e non usano il buffering e trasferiscono blocchi di dati. Inoltre, è a thread singolo con loop di eventi che viene utilizzato in modo non bloccante. Il modulo HTTP può aiutare nella creazione di un server usando il metodo createServer (). Questo metodo viene eseguito ogni volta che qualcuno tenta di accedere alla porta 8080. In risposta a ciò, il server HTTP dovrebbe visualizzare HTML e dovrebbe essere incluso nell'intestazione HTTP. Può essere installato facilmente digitando 'npm install -g http-server' e può essere avviato digitando il comando http-server.

6.Games:

Non solo i siti Web, ma l'uso di JavaScript aiuta anche a creare giochi per il tempo libero. La combinazione di JavaScript e HTML5 rende JavaScript popolare anche nello sviluppo di giochi. Fornisce la libreria Ease JS che fornisce soluzioni semplici per lavorare con una grafica ricca. Ha anche un'API familiare a tutti gli sviluppatori flash con un elenco di visualizzazione gerarchico. Un utente può creare uno stage e visualizzerà l'elenco di visualizzazione nell'area di disegno di destinazione. Ease JS ha anche bitmap 2D chiamate Sprites che sono disegnate direttamente per rendere il bersaglio per le trasformazioni.

7.Art:

L'uso dell'HTML5 in JavaScript per disegnare grafici su una pagina Web è diventato più semplice. Tutte le forme bidimensionali e tridimensionali possono essere facilmente disegnate su una tela e questo ha aperto il browser come nuovo mezzo per tutti i diversi progetti di arte digitale. Una tela non ha bordi né contenuto e quindi consente all'utente di creare la propria arte.

8.Applicazioni smartwatch:

Javascript è la lingua più utilizzata perché è utilizzata in tutti i dispositivi e applicazioni possibili. l'uso di JavaScript fornisce una libreria Pebble JS che viene utilizzata nelle applicazioni smartwatch. Questo framework funziona per applicazioni che richiedono Internet per il suo funzionamento. L'uso di Pebbles consente a uno sviluppatore di creare un'applicazione per un numero di orologi utilizzando JavaScript.

9.Applicazioni mobili:

La cosa più importante che può essere fatta dagli usi di JavaScript è la creazione di applicazioni senza contesti web. I cellulari essendo disponibili principalmente in Apple e Android, vengono usati in due lingue diverse per costruirli. Dovrebbe essere possibile scrivere una volta e usarlo su entrambe le piattaforme di questi dispositivi. PhoneGap è il framework che consente questo. Anche di recente abbiamo React Native che serve a questo scopo. È il principale attore nelle modifiche e nelle distribuzioni multipiattaforma. Quindi gli usi di Javascript possono essere utilizzati per distribuire e scaricare le rispettive applicazioni su più ambienti.

10. Robot di volo:

Sì, anche questo è il campo che non è stato toccato da JavaScript. Utilizzando Node Js un utente può programmare un robot volante.

Conclusione - Usi di JavaScript

Come risultato di tutte le precedenti applicazioni di JavaScript, sarebbe abbastanza chiaro che JavaScript è la lingua che deve rimanere. Con tutte le funzionalità di uno sviluppo front-end e back-end, JavaScript aiuta a supportare entrambi e a creare alcune delle migliori applicazioni che possono essere utilizzate in tutto il mondo.

Articoli consigliati:

Questa è stata una guida all'uso di JavaScript nel mondo reale. Qui abbiamo discusso le diverse applicazioni di JavaScript come giochi, server Web, sviluppo web ecc. Puoi anche leggere il seguente articolo per saperne di più -

  1. Domande di intervista Javascript
  2. Carriere in JavaScript
  3. Strumenti e vantaggi di sviluppo Web JavaScript
  4. Capex vs Opex: vuoi sapere qual è il bestx
  5. React Native vs Swift | Top 12 differenze e infografiche

Categoria: